Siena (9-6) at Canisius (2-13)

GAME NOTES: Still waiting for their first win in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ference action this season, the Canisius Golden Griffins give it another shot this afternoon as they host the Siena Saints at the Koessler Center in Buffalo. Canisius has a grand total of just two wins this season, coming against the likes of Coastal Carolina and Maine and since that victory over the Black Bears on New Year's Eve, the Griffs had dropped three in a row. On Friday night, the squad bowed to Manhattan at home by a final of 69-65, dropping Canisius to 0-5 in MAAC play. As for the Saints, they picked up their fourth league win in five chances two nights ago when they toppled Niagara on the road, 94-84. The win was the second in the last three games for Siena, which has alternated wins and losses now over the last six contests. Canisius has lost three in a row to the Saints recently, which has led to Siena taking a 40-36 advantage in the all-time series

Edwin Ubiles shot not only 11-of-14 from the field, he also converted 4-of-6 behind the three-point line en route to his team-high 28 points in the win over Niagara on Friday. Tay Fisher and Ronald Moore checked in with 18 points apiece, the latter adding seven assists and six rebounds as well, while Alex Franklin contributed 12 points off the bench. The leading scorer in each of the last two games, Ubiles is producing a healthy 17.2 ppg for himself so far in 2007-08. Not only is he shooting 55.5 percent from the field, he has converted 19-of-37 (.514) beyond the arc as well, helping the team to reach 41.1 percent from the perimeter as a group. The only player to have started every game thus far, Kenny Hasbrouck accounts for 15.4 ppg, while Franklin and Moore chip in 15.1 and 10.2 ppg, respectively, for a team coming up with close to 80 ppg this season.

Frank Turner used his 39 minutes of the floor Friday night to come up with a team-best 18 points, but his efforts were not quite enough as Canisius bowed to the Jaspers by four points at home. Jovan Robinson hit on 4-of-6 beyond the arc to arrive at his 15 points off the bench, while Greg Logins posted 12 points and a team-best eight rebounds as well. When it comes to conference play this season the Golden Griffins have been simply awful, scoring a mere 56.2 ppg while allowing MAAC foes a hefty 76.2 ppg. In those five outings Canisius doesn't have a single player who is scoring in double figures on a consistent basis. Taking into account all 15 games thus far, Turner is tops on the scoring list with his 11.5 ppg and is also tops with 76 assists. Except for Robinson (8.6 ppg), Turner is the only player on the roster with more assists than turnovers at the moment, the team averaging about 17 miscues per contest.

Canisius nearly got over on the Jaspers a couple nights ago, but against a team like Siena the Griffs haven't got a prayer.
